Off-Grid Rustic Home Built in the Ozark Hills
This unique project represents a return to traditional Ozark living, blending craftsmanship, self-sufficiency, and regional heritage into a fully off-grid home nestled in the woods between Competition, Hartville, and Norwood. While our work typically focuses on modern home construction, this build honors the lifestyle of earlier generations who lived simply and resourcefully in the Ozark hills.
The home is constructed using locally milled lumber and cedar poles harvested directly from the property, ensuring the structure blends naturally into its surroundings. Salvaged doors and windows were carefully incorporated to preserve a rustic aesthetic and give new life to materials with history and character. Every design decision was made with intention, prioritizing durability, authenticity, and respect for traditional building methods.
Designed for complete off-grid living, the home features a Pioneer Maid wood cookstove that serves as both the primary cooking appliance and heat source. Water is drawn from a hand pump located in the yard, and facilities include an Ozark-style outhouse, reflecting time-tested solutions that sustained families in this region for generations.
